City budget comparison not apples-to-apples

Dori, your comparison of Seattle’s budget compared to other cities is flawed. Seattle’s budget includes money from their utilities like Seattle City Light and Seattle Public Utilities, which is substantial. Other cities you have mentioned do not have municipal utilities, and so those monies are not included in their budget. A true apples-to-apples comparison would account for that.

– Dave in Renton

Vape ban could lead to more cigarette smokers

I quit a two-pack-a-day smoking habit by vaping, so it’s not really all that silly. What you should research is the big tobacco settlement, payments to the state(s) because of that settlement, and the bonds that are being defaulted on because of the state(s) losing money due to a significant reduction in smokers (and, consequently, an increase in vapers). The state(s) will do anything to keep their income streaming in, even if it means forcing every vaper to return to the much more hazardous habit of smoking.

– Jeff in Mountlake Terrace
